Visa is seeking a seasoned and highly motivated leader in the Commercial and Money Movement Solutions Product Development (CMS PD) group in the role Vice President, Engineering reporting to Senior Vice President, CMS PD.
Commercial and Money Movement Solutions (CMS) is a strategic growth pillar for Visa that will deliver significant revenue for the company over the coming years. CMS is focused on driving Visa’s strategy to expand beyond core Consumer to Business (C2B) payments into broader money movement flows across individuals, businesses, and governments. The CMS PD team within Visa Technology is chartered with building the platforms and product capabilities that will directly enable the growth aspirations of our CMS business.
As Vice President Engineering in CMS PD, you will be a key leader in our organization chartered to infuse next generation thinking into product development practices, anticipate and leverage emerging technologies for strategic advantage, and drive innovation initiatives to deliver a highly differentiated product offering to our clients.
Functionally, the role will be responsible for defining and executing on the technology strategy for Commercial Data Products, B2B Agentic Commerce and Agent driven pre and post transaction value added solutions. This role will drive the evolution of the commercial data platform that ingests and transforms commercial transaction, settlement and enhanced data to deliver comprehensive reconciliation information and business insights for clients. This role will also be responsible for driving our agent driven solutions in the end-to-end B2B commerce, enabling secure, trusted, and intelligent transaction outcomes across Visa’s commercial network.
